> Currently Mllib modeling tools work only with double data. However, data
> tables in practice often have a set of categorical fields (factors in R),
> that need to be converted to a set of 0/1 indicator variables (making the
> data actually used in a modeling algorithm completely numeric). In R, this is
> handled in modeling functions using the model.matrix function. Similar
> functionality needs to be available within Spark.
